Critical Health and Safety Information
Keeping our flag, tackle, and cheer athletes safe is our top priority. With this mindset along with the anticipated hot weather, we are immediately enacting preemptive measures for player safety to include no pads for tackle players first 2 days (tackle football participants will be receiving another email with additional details.) Additional measures may be enacted to include last minute cancelation of practices. Please keep your eyes open for potentially last minute changes from the organization and your specific sport. Such measures will be communicated via Eagles Facebook page (https://www.facebook.com/PrinceFrederickEagles/) and emails.
We need your help!! How can you help …
Starting the day before practice, the young athlete should start hydrating by drinking plenty of water. Water is preferable, but if the athlete is resisting, use their favorite sports drink. Important: if they are thirsty, they are already dehydrated. After practice, sports drinks are preferable because they replenish electrolytes. Rehydration after practice is extremely important. It’s up to the parents to ensure their athletes begin the rehydration process immediately after practice.
During the first weeks of practice, coaches are still learning several player’s behaviors and may not be able to identify a change as quickly as you. If you identify a potential medical concern, please notify coaches/org contacts within your area.
Please nourish athletes before and after practice. Avoid dairy products, i.e. milk, prior to start of practice. The night before and 2 hours before exercise: focus on carbs, moderate protein, low-fat foods and fluids.
